Output 85d869a91aa0d2a0d6caf2db485c925431a7bac2785c2e1908f89cfbbee8a9ab:34

value
11828878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29d41fa42fc0228130e4ada44eaa6e94316aac65 OP_EQUAL
address
35WBk1pCY78itY7v8hnHhDpPMtTNVS8aNt
transaction
85d869a91aa0d2a0d6caf2db485c925431a7bac2785c2e1908f89cfbbee8a9ab
spent
true